How do you use cadence in a sentence?

Here are some examples of how to use "cadence" in a sentence, illustrating different meanings:

Rhythm and Flow:

* The cadence of the speaker's voice was soothing and hypnotic.

* The cadence of the music was upbeat and energetic.

* The poem's cadence was broken by a jarring, unexpected rhyme.

Military:

* The soldiers marched in perfect cadence, their boots hitting the pavement in unison.

* The sergeant called out the marching cadence.

* The cadence of the drumbeat quickened as the troops approached the battlefield.

Technical:

* The cadence of the processor is measured in megahertz.

* The engineer adjusted the cadence of the signal to improve transmission quality.

* The cadence of the machine's operation was smooth and efficient.

Figurative:

* The cadence of the day shifted from morning's rush to evening's quiet.

* The cadence of her life had changed dramatically since she moved to the city.

* The rhythm of the waves, their constant cadence, calmed her racing thoughts.
